Quick & Easy Macramé is a stunning collection of 12 projects for homewares and accessories.
Delve into the art of mini macramé with 12 projects ranging from home décor to fashion items, perfect for beginners and the more advanced alike. Each project and technique is accompanied by step-by-step instructions, making learning mini macramé quick and stress-free!
The projects range from creating a cute and simple pencil case—ideal for beginners—to beautifully designed animal wall hangings suitable for any children's bedroom, perfect for the more advanced crafter to try. This book will provide readers with hours of creative fun and relaxation.
Quick & Easy Macramé offers a delightful journey into crafting, guided by authors Tansy Wilson and Sian Hamilton, who bring their extensive experience and creativity to the forefront.
Authors: Tansy Wilson is based in Somerset, UK, and has twenty years of experience in the craft industry. She teaches jewellery design at her local Further Education College. Tansy is a regular contributor to GMC's magazines and has also had books published by GMC Publications.
Sian Hamilton has been a designer for over twenty years and holds a BA (Hons) in 3D Design. Introduced to sewing by her grandmother, who was a seamstress, Sian started sewing clothes for herself in her teenage years before progressing to making custom wedding dresses for clients early in her career. She is the author of several books on jewellery making and sewing from GMC Publications and currently lives in Camberley, UK.
Tansy and Sian met at university while studying for a BA in 3D Design. They have both been in the design industry for over 25 years and have collaborated on many magazine and book projects within the craft sector. Together, they aim to combine their creative ideas to introduce a range of simple craft skills to a wider audience. They have also co-authored Macrame and Air-Dry Clay.
